[Postfixbuch-users] Test-Spool erzeugen
Stefan Förster
cite+postfix-buch at incertum.net
Sa Jun 21 15:04:58 CEST 2008
Hallo Welt,
nachdem wir mittlerweile mit der Evaluation der Funktionalität unseres
angestrebten neuen Setups fertig sind (Backend-Clustering, Patches
gegen amavisd-new & Perl, Change-Management etc.) würden wir gerne
harte Zahlen zur Performance sammeln - Anazahl der
content_filter-Prozesse, Einstellungen an den Content-Filtern, den
DB-Backends etc.
Meine erste Idee dazu war eigentlich recht einfach: Man versetzt die
gesamte Testumgebung in einen definierten Zustand (leere DNS-Caches,
leere FS-Caches), stoppt Postfix, schiebt ihm einen sehr großen Spool
unter (das muß gar nicht mal in pickup sein, sondern von mir aus auch
gleich in Incoming oder gar Active) und startet Postfix wieder.
Während sich das System dann durch ein paar 100k Nachrichten knabbert,
geht man auf die Dachterasse... ich schweife ab.
Das Problem mit der Idee ist nun ein unheimlich triviales: Wie erzeuge
ich diesen Spool? Idealerweise würde ich einfach ein laufendes Postfix
dazu bewegen, seinen Spool doppelt anzulegen - dann hätte ich nach ein
paar Tagen genau die Art realer Daten, die ich brauche. Blöderweise
scheint das nicht möglich zu sein.
Natürlich kann ich einfach eine Woche lang mit BCC arbeiten, die
Nachrichten dann auslesen, die Header modifizieren und dann wieder
lokal injecten - mit Realität hat das aber nicht viel zu tun, genauso
wenig wie das Einliefern der Nachrichten von Test-Clients aus.
Wie geht man sowas an?
Ciao
Stefan
--
Stefan Förster http://www.incertum.net/ Public Key: 0xBBE2A9E9
FdI #153: höflich - Abwesenheit von absichtlichen Beleidigungen. (Lars
Marowsky-Brée)
Mehr Informationen über die Mailingliste Postfixbuch-users